Well that's finally done n dusted and now to get some serious weight loss registered. My husband told his friends I was having surgery because of a mid life crisis, and I suppose I was, but not how he meant. It was more of an epiphany - a realisation that if I didn't make this effort like my mum I was going to be taken way too early, and I want to watch my grandkids get married and have their own kids. The op went well, my surgeon is an awesome woman, and being a mother herself knew what my goal was. I suffered some nausea but that was from the pain relief. Once that was stopped it was fine. I didn't realise I would have to have blood thinner every day I was hospitalised but if that's a precaution I needed, so be it. The gas build up is a little uncomfortable and a very helpful nurse gave me a heat pack for my shoulder that unfortunately was too hot and left a lovely scald mark. I have to become familiar with how much I can consume to prevent me overeating. My head is saying eat more, that's not enough but the new stomach is not agreeing with the glutton head thank goodness. Just some tweaking to get them in unison and it should be fine. Just wondering though, still no bowel movement after 4 days, should I be asking for a laxative????

Hi folks, I have started the optifast diet and it has had its ups and down. I must be a [RS bleep] as I have been baking cakes and cupcakes for my family, and that was my downfall before I opted for the sleeve. How perverse that I am now having to watch everyone eat the cakes I have been cooking. So far ok with Optifast. My dietician has said I am to have 5 meals, B, MT, L, AT, D. I can have 2 cups vegetables and 1 tsp oil with my Optifast for lunch and dinner. I had a real battle with myself when my son ordered a pizza for dinner. But I persevered as I just want to give myself the best chance at being a slim me after the surgery. I am wondering if anyone had prepared paleo bone broth for after surgery. If I skim off any fat and strain out the vegetables, will this be suitable for me after the op??
